Output bf66ca5296159941fb4d31ad4fb8f1fe34e4b72d8f5792e452757692f1be7260:1

value
4341026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50a307715ae4dd4fb6fb014540811d085caf72d1 OP_EQUAL
address
393PHMBb6UgRn6aRLgm3QwRHyCesNnj2uu
transaction
bf66ca5296159941fb4d31ad4fb8f1fe34e4b72d8f5792e452757692f1be7260
spent
true